A new synthetic protocol for the preparation of 3-aryl-3-methoxycarbonyl cyclopropenes with an unsubstituted double bond has been developed that allowed for expanded substrate scope and improved product yields. The method involves Rh(II)-catalyzed transfer of carbenoids generated from unpurified aryldiazoesters, followed by desilylation, and is compatible with a wide range of aryldiazoesters. The employed continuous extraction of hardly soluble crude diazoesters helps avoid laborious and often cost-prohibitive isolation and purification of sensitive diazoester precursors.Image for unlabelled figure
